Output 684f32e6f81ef06e8d0b47e7e1a63be3a5dec20e9e0f18774781e530d8f0a95a:3

value
154000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4850c049fcefe0ab8cee8ce58ea9f66070c4137 OP_EQUALVERIFY OP_CHECKSIG
address
1LNhdw3snxQ9pvxtpb5MSnAF5TTTQiTeXt
transaction
684f32e6f81ef06e8d0b47e7e1a63be3a5dec20e9e0f18774781e530d8f0a95a